摘要:

试验旨在研究日粮中添加抗菌肽及益生菌复合添加剂对青脚麻鸡生长性能和屠宰性能及血清生化指标的影响。选择7日龄初始体重相近的青脚麻鸡460羽,随机分为5组,每组4个重复,每个重复23羽,分别饲喂5种不同的日粮:Ⅰ组饲喂基础日粮+150 mg/kg金霉素(对照组),Ⅱ、Ⅲ、Ⅳ、Ⅴ组分别在基础日粮中添加200、400、600和800 mg/kg添加剂。试验期56 d。结果显示:①前期Ⅲ、Ⅳ和Ⅴ组平均日采食量均有提高,其中Ⅳ、Ⅴ组与Ⅰ组相比均达到显著水平(P < 0.05);Ⅱ、Ⅲ、Ⅳ和Ⅴ组平均日增重均有提高,其中Ⅳ组与Ⅰ组相比达到显著水平(P < 0.05);Ⅱ、Ⅲ和Ⅳ组平均料重比均有降低,其中Ⅱ、Ⅳ组与Ⅰ组相比均达到显著水平(P < 0.05)。后期和全期平均日采食量、平均日增重和平均料重比各组差异均不显著(P > 0.05)。②各组与对照组相比,全净膛率、胸肌率和腿肌率均有一定程度的提高,但各组差异均不显著(P > 0.05)。③与对照组相比,Ⅲ、Ⅳ和Ⅴ组血清总蛋白含量分别提高了1.18%、12.11%和29.28%;Ⅲ、Ⅳ和Ⅴ组血清白蛋白含量分别显著提高了23.87%、22.28%和23.05%(P < 0.05);Ⅲ、Ⅳ和Ⅴ组碱性磷酸酶活性分别提高了12.07%、13.17%和29.67%;Ⅱ、Ⅲ、Ⅳ和Ⅴ组谷草转氨酶活性分别提高了0.95%、16.22%、92.95%和137.94%,其中Ⅳ和Ⅴ组均达到显著水平(P < 0.05)。结果表明,在青脚麻鸡日粮中添加抗菌肽和益生菌复合添加剂,可提高青脚麻鸡血清中总蛋白、白蛋白含量及碱性磷酸酶、谷草转氨酶活性,促进青脚麻鸡营养物质代谢,从而提高青脚麻鸡的生长性能和屠宰性能。

Abstract:

The research was aimed to study the effects of composite additives of antimicrobial peptides and probiotics on growth performance,slaughter performance and serum biochemical indexes in Partridge Shank chickens.The total of 460 7-day-old Partridge Shank chickens with similar body weight were randomly divided into 5 groups with 4 replicates each group,23 birds per replicate.The chickens in control group were fed with basal diet with 150 mg/kg aureomycin (group Ⅰ),the chickens in treatment groups were fed with composite additive of antimicrobial peptides and probiotics with level of 200 mg/kg (group Ⅱ),400 mg/kg (group Ⅲ),600 mg/kg (group Ⅳ) and 800 mg/kg (group Ⅴ),respectively.The experiment lasted for 56 days.The results showed that:①Compared with control group in the early period,the ADFI in treatment groups except group Ⅱ increased and significant difference was observed in groups Ⅳ and Ⅴ(P < 0.05).The ADG in all treatment groups increased and significant difference was observed in group Ⅳ(P < 0.05).The F/G in group Ⅴ increased lightly and decreased in other treatment groups with significant difference in groups Ⅱ and Ⅳ (P < 0.05).There were no significant difference in the ADFI,ADG and F/G among groups in the later period and the whole period (P > 0.05).②Compared with control group,percentage of eviscerated yield,breast muscle and leg muscle had a certain increase (P > 0.05).③Serum total protein in groups Ⅲ,Ⅳ and Ⅴ were 1.18%,12.11% and 29.28% higher than that of control group,respectively.Serum albumin in groups Ⅲ,Ⅳand Ⅴ were 23.87%,22.28% and 23.05% higher than that of control group,respectively (P < 0.05).The ALP activity in groups Ⅲ,Ⅳ and Ⅴ were 12.07%,13.17% and 29.67% higher than that of control group, respectively.The AST activity in groups Ⅱ,Ⅲ,Ⅳ and Ⅴ were 0.95%,16.22%,92.95% and 137.94% higher than that of control group,respectively,and significant differences were found in groups Ⅳ and Ⅴ (P < 0.05).Supplementation of composite additive of antimicrobial peptides and probiotics to substitute antibiotics in Partridge Shank chickens diet could increase the content of serum total protein and albumin,activity of ALP and AST,promote the nutrient metabolism and improve the growth and slaughter performance in Partridge Shank chickens.
